National disasters, political upheavals, climatic changes, wars, economic uncertainties: the world is ever churning, and at different times, businesses face different challenges that affect their business prospects. Some internal risks, such as failures in meeting quality and quantity requirements by suppliers, equipment failure, process failures, and so on, can cause product deviations. This can result in nonconformance and noncompliance, affecting the cost of production, reputation, and timely delivery of products.
Knowing when they may face a challenge, how it will affect them, and what they can do to mitigate the impact is very valuable for businesses to minimize the impact. Risk management is also a regulatory requirement in many industries and includes internal risks.

Although risk management has always been an integral part of any business’s growth strategy, being prepared and implementing effective controls can be difficult in the absence of data. Risk management cannot be confined to the top management alone and also requires every employee and worker to know what the controls to risks in their functional areas are and ensure they are aligned with the quality assurance requirements to be effective.
Data analytics enables business leaders to make informed decisions about risks, implement suitable controls, and empower their employees with tools to mitigate and monitor risks at their level. This can help businesses protect themselves from operational disruptions, financial crises, and uncertainties.
With the advent of Industry 4.0 technologies, businesses have access to vast amounts of data that can help uncover even hidden risks. This is possible using historical data, external data sets, and real-time data from various processes to help quality leaders identify patterns, capture trends, and establish correlations. This will enable a proactive approach to risk management, thereby reducing disruptions due to unexpected events.
Identification of Risks: By enabling the identification of patterns and trends, data analysis helps organizations uncover vulnerabilities and potential risks.
Assessment and Prioritization of Risks: Risks can be of different types—high, medium, and low. Organizations cannot manage all risks, as it will drain resources. High risks are the priority areas that need to be addressed first. Therefore, risk management tools enable ranking the risks for resource optimization.
Mitigation of Risks: Once high and medium risks have been identified, predictive models can be developed using statistical modeling and machine learning algorithms. This helps assess their impact and identify control measures to mitigate them.
Monitoring and Tracking: Risk monitoring must assess the effectiveness of the control measures. This helps with mid-course correction if needed and detects and manages emerging risks.
In a highly dynamic environment, data analytics can help businesses with the following:
Improved Decision-Making: Quality and business leaders can get actionable insights that help improve the quality of decisions. This enables the assessment and analysis of various risk scenarios to better evaluate risks and their impact, enabling informed decision-making.
Lowers Costs: By identifying and mitigating risks in a timely manner, organizations can take prompt and appropriate action to prevent costly mistakes. Quality teams can take action proactively, optimize resource allocation, and reduce the costs of corrections and rework.
Enhanced Compliance: Risk identification also helps uncover gaps in compliance gaps and address them promptly to meet regulatory requirements.
Optimize Processes: Data analytics also helps identify inefficiencies and bottlenecks in processes that can be corrected to improve workflow effectiveness.

Artificial intelligence (AI) and machine learning (ML) algorithms are further improving the effectiveness of data analytics in risk mitigation. They are improving the accuracy of risk predictions and the effectiveness of risk management strategies.
Access to real-time data sources and advanced data visualization provide valuable insights to identify and respond to risks in real-time. AI can also be used to augment decision-making, improving the quality of decisions to mitigate risks.
